Developing a penetration testing tool such as Kali Linux requires huge technical expertise, advanced security knowledge, and a significant investment. With its features ranging from vulnerability scanning to real-world attack simulations, Kali Linux is the ultimate tool for cybersecurity professionals.
Creating a similar tool is not a simple programming issue, as it requires deep knowledge about the security features in networking and vulnerabilities of their applications along with user-friendly interfaces. Among these factors, the degree of complexity in security, adhering to cybersecurity standards, and the expertise of the development team are major elements deciding the cost.
Generally, developing a penetration testing tool costs about $30,000 to $200,000 depending on the features, platform compatibility, and needs for ongoing maintenance. Such investment ensures a robust, scalable, and potent solution for security experts' needs.
In this blog, let's discuss the major influencers of these costs in detail.
Understanding the Benefits of Penetration Testing Tools
Penetration testing tools offer a holistic approach to securing systems, networks, and applications. Some of its benefits include:
-
Early Vulnerability Identification: Detect weaknesses in your system before attackers exploit them, enabling prompt fixes and reducing risks.
-
Real-world Attack Simulations: Emulate potential cyberattacks to test your defenses against advanced threats and improve response strategies.
-
Regulatory Compliance: Meet industry standards and legal requirements by demonstrating proactive security measures.
-
Risk Mitigation: Reduce the likelihood and impact of cyber threats by identifying and addressing vulnerabilities.
-
Customer Confidence: Illustrate commitment to protecting user data, and enhancing trust and loyalty among clients and stakeholders.
-
Continuous Improvement: Know your testing lessons and time to improve and strengthen your security protocols.
-
Proactive Threat Management: Position yourself ahead of emerging threats by regularly assessing and improving your security posture.
Incorporating penetration testing tools helps businesses protect themselves effectively and stay ahead in the competitive cyber-driven world of today.
Factors Affecting the Cost of Developing a Penetration Testing Tool Like Kali Linux
There are several critical factors to influence the cost of development for a penetration testing tool:
-
Complexity and Customization of Security Features: High-end features and customizable security tools add up to the developmental time and cost.
-
User Interface and Experience Design for Security Tools: Good UI/UX design according to the needs of cyber professionals improves usability but also consumes additional resources.
-
Storage of Data and Security Measures: Secure data handling, encryption, and storage capabilities increase development costs.
-
Compatibility with Cybersecurity Frameworks and Platforms: Compatibility with existing frameworks like OWASP or MITRE ATT&CK requires much effort.
-
Meeting Compliance with Cybersecurity Regulatory Standards: Thorough testing and certification are required to achieve compliance on a global level, and all these add to the expenses.
-
Expertise and Location of Development Team: The location and the expertise of the team influence labor cost and project quality.
-
Ongoing Support, Maintenance, and Security Updates: This requires ongoing investment and continuous updates in support to combat emerging threats.
Both these factors make up the overall cost thus making planning very essential for building the right tools.
Key Features of a Penetration Testing Software like Kali Linux
A penetration testing software such as Kali Linux comes loaded with robust features for thorough security analysis.
-
Vulnerability Scanning: Scans and analyzes vulnerabilities in the networks, systems, and applications.
-
Comprehensive Toolset: Contains tools that facilitate the job of reconnaissance, exploitation, and post-exploitation.
-
Platform Compatibility: Suitable for various operating systems and environments.
-
Customizability: Enables users to configure the tools and scripts to specific test needs.
-
Regular Updates: Available with the latest security tools and patches.
-
User-Friendly Interface: Simplified workflows for cybersecurity newcomers and veterans alike.
These factors make penetration testing software a necessity for enhancing digital defense.
Steps to Develop a Penetration Testing Tool Like Kali Linux
Developing a penetration testing tool like Kali Linux involves a structured approach:
-
Define Objectives
-
Design Architecture
-
Incorporate Security Tools
-
Develop Custom Features
-
Ensure Compliance
-
Test and Optimize
-
Provide Maintenance
This roadmap ensures a reliable and efficient penetration testing tool.
Osiz is Your Reliable Partner in Penetration Testing Tool Development
A leading App development company, Osiz excels in developing high-performance penetration testing tools tailored to meet various cybersecurity challenges. With years of experience and a commitment to innovation, Osiz provides solutions that integrate advanced features with seamless usability and compatibility across multiple platforms.
Our emphasize the development of tools ensuring that these are delivered with standards set across the world to perform secure and efficient vulnerability assessment. Osiz provides continuous maintenance and support as well as updates to ensure that tools are resistant to new, changing threats. Let Osiz be your partner for dependability in building strong penetration testing tools for safeguarding your systems and for your security enhancement.